The Pearl Hotel in San Diego is a distinctive boutique hotel that seamlessly blends mid-century modern aesthetics with contemporary comforts, offering guests a unique and casual escape. Nestled in the vibrant Point Loma neighborhood, The Pearl Hotel places visitors close to the city's attractions while providing a tranquil retreat away from the hustle and bustle.
Upon arrival, guests are greeted by a welcoming atmosphere that reflects the charm and character of the 1960s, with chic design elements thoughtfully interwoven throughout the property. The Pearl Hotel prides itself on creating a personal and intimate guest experience, offering well-appointed accommodations that cater to the needs of modern travelers. Each room features stylish décor that echoes the hotel's retro theme, coupled with amenities such as complimentary Wi-Fi and flat-screen televisions for added convenience.
Beyond the rooms, The Pearl Hotel boasts a lively social hub centered around its iconic oyster-shaped swimming pool. The pool area serves as the backdrop for a range of activities, from relaxed lounging to the hotel's popular Dive-In Theatre event, where classic films are screened poolside under the stars. Guests are also invited to indulge in culinary delights at the hotel's popular on-site restaurant and bar, which serves up a menu of fresh, locally-sourced dishes alongside crafted cocktails.
The Pearl Hotel is an ideal choice for travelers seeking a blend of style, relaxation, and authentic San Diego vibes, making it a memorable destination for those who appreciate intimate settings with distinctive flair.
San Diego offers a diverse range of activities and attractions suitable for various interests. One of the primary draws is Balboa Park, a sprawling urban park that features numerous museums, gardens, and the famous San Diego Zoo. Exploring the gardens and cultural institutions provides a serene escape and an opportunity to appreciate art and history.
Another appealing aspect of San Diego is its beautiful beaches. Areas like La Jolla Shores, Coronado Beach, and Mission Beach provide ample opportunities for sunbathing, swimming, and water sports. Each beach has its own unique atmosphere, making it easy to find a spot that suits your preferences.
For those interested in maritime history, the USS Midway Museum offers a chance to explore a retired aircraft carrier. The museum features interactive exhibits and historical artifacts, providing insight into naval aviation and military life.
Visitors can also enjoy the vibrant gaslamp quarter, known for its Victorian architecture and lively nightlife. The area is home to a variety of restaurants, bars, and shops, making it a popular destination for dining and entertainment.
Nature enthusiasts may appreciate Torrey Pines State Natural Reserve, where scenic hiking trails offer stunning views of the coastline and opportunities to see native wildlife. The reserve is a great place for outdoor activities while enjoying the natural beauty of the area.
Finally, indulging in San Diego's culinary scene is a must. With a focus on fresh seafood and a diverse array of international cuisines, the city offers numerous dining options that cater to different tastes and preferences. Whether you choose to dine at a beachfront restaurant or explore local food markets, the culinary experiences in San Diego are noteworthy.
In summary, San Diego presents a variety of activities that cater to cultural, recreational, and culinary interests, making it a well-rounded destination.
